如何使用bak文件进行数据备份恢复
备份的bak文件怎么用

首页 2025-06-11 03:05:41



备份的BAK文件怎么用:全面解析与实战指南 在信息爆炸的时代,数据的重要性不言而喻

    无论是个人用户还是企业机构,数据备份都是一项至关重要的任务

    在众多备份文件中,BAK文件作为一种常见的备份格式,扮演着举足轻重的角色

    然而,许多用户对BAK文件的使用方法并不熟悉,导致备份数据在关键时刻无法发挥作用

    本文将全面解析BAK文件的用途、恢复方法以及实战技巧,帮助用户充分利用这一重要的数据保障工具

     一、BAK文件简介 BAK文件,全称Backup File,即备份文件

    它是一种扩展名为“.bak”的文件格式,主要用于存储原始文件的备份副本

    当原始文件因各种原因(如误删除、损坏、病毒感染等)丢失或无法正常使用时,用户可以通过BAK文件恢复数据

    BAK文件广泛应用于各种软件和系统中,如数据库、配置文件、应用程序等

     二、BAK文件的用途 1.数据恢复:BAK文件最直接的用途就是数据恢复

    当原始文件被误删除、损坏或感染病毒时,用户可以通过重命名或复制BAK文件来恢复数据

    例如,如果一个名为“document.txt”的文件被误删除,而相应的“document.bak”文件存在,用户只需将“document.bak”重命名为“document.txt”即可恢复文件

     2.版本管理:在某些情况下,用户可能需要回溯到文件的早期版本

    BAK文件可以作为版本管理的一种手段,存储文件的旧版本,以便在需要时恢复

    这对于文档编辑、软件开发等领域尤为重要

     3.灾难恢复:对于企业机构而言,BAK文件在灾难恢复计划中发挥着关键作用

    通过定期备份关键数据和系统文件,企业可以在遭遇自然灾害、硬件故障等突发事件时,迅速恢复业务运行

     三、BAK文件的恢复方法 1.直接重命名恢复: - 找到原始文件所在的目录

     - 确认BAK文件存在且未被损坏

     - 将BAK文件的扩展名从“.bak”更改为原始文件的扩展名

    例如,将“document.bak”重命名为“document.txt”

     - 打开重命名后的文件,检查数据是否完整

     2.使用软件恢复: - 对于某些特定软件生成的BAK文件,可能需要使用专门的恢复工具

    例如,数据库管理系统(如MySQL、SQL Server)通常提供内置的恢复功能,用户可以通过这些功能导入BAK文件以恢复数据库

     - 在选择恢复软件时,请确保软件与BAK文件的格式兼容,并遵循软件的恢复指南进行操作

     3.命令行恢复: - 对于高级用户,可以通过命令行工具恢复BAK文件

    例如,在Linux或Unix系统中,可以使用`cp`命令复制BAK文件,并使用`mv`命令重命名文件

     - 在Windows系统中,可以使用命令提示符或PowerShell执行类似的文件操作

     四、实战技巧与注意事项 1.定期备份: -养成定期备份数据的习惯

    根据数据的重要性和变化频率,制定合理的备份计划

     - 对于关键数据和系统文件,建议每天或每周进行一次完整备份,并保留多个版本的BAK文件以应对不同需求

     2.分类存储: - 将BAK文件与原始文件分开存储

    这不仅可以避免混淆,还可以在原始文件丢失时迅速找到备份副本

     - 建议使用专门的备份目录或存储设备来存储BAK文件,并确保这些存储设备的安全性和可靠性

     3.测试恢复: - 定期测试BAK文件的恢复过程

    这可以确保在关键时刻能够顺利恢复数据,并发现潜在的问题和故障

     - 在测试恢复时,请务必在安全的测试环境中进行,避免对生产数据造成不必要的影响

     4.权限管理: - 对BAK文件进行严格的权限管理

    确保只有授权用户才能访问和修改这些文件,以防止数据泄露和篡改

     - 在企业环境中,建议使用集中式的备份管理系统来监控和管理BAK文件的权限和访问日志

     5.加密保护: - 对于包含敏感信息的BAK文件,建议使用加密技术进行保护

    这可以确保即使BAK文件被非法获取,也无法轻易读取其中的数据

     - 在选择加密工具时,请确保其与BAK文件的格式兼容,并遵循最佳的加密实践来确保数据的安全性

     6.文档记录: - 记录BAK文件的创建时间、备份内容、恢复方法等关键信息

    这有助于在需要时快速定位和使用BAK文件

     - 建议使用电子文档或专门的备份管理系统来记录这些信息,并确保文档的准确性和可访问性

     7.灾难恢复计划: - 制定详细的灾难恢复计划,并将BAK文件作为其中的重要组成部分

    这可以确保在遭遇突发事件时,能够迅速启动恢复流程并恢复关键数据和业务运行

     - 在制定灾难恢复计划时,请考虑各种可能的灾难场景和恢复需求,并制定相应的恢复策略和步骤

     8.培训与意识提升: - 对员工进行定期的备份和恢复培训

    这可以提高员工对数据备份重要性的认识,并让他们熟悉BAK文件的使用方法和恢复流程

     - 通过培训,员工可以了解如何识别潜在的备份风险、如何执行备份操作以及如何在需要时恢复数据

     五、案例分析:BAK文件在数据恢复中的实际应用 以下是一个关于BAK文件在数据恢复中实际应用的案例: 某家企业的重要文档服务器因硬件故障突然宕机,导致大量关键文档丢失

    幸运的是,该企业之前已经制定了详细的备份计划,并定期将文档备份到专门的BAK文件中

    在故障发生后,企业迅速启动了灾难恢复计划,并利用BAK文件恢复了丢失的文档

     在恢复过程中,企业首先确认了BAK文件的完整性和可用性,然后使用专门的恢复工具将这些文件导入到新的服务器上

    经过几个小时的努力,所有丢失的文档都被成功恢复,企业的业务运行也迅速恢复正常

     这个案例充分展示了BAK文件在数据恢复中的重要性

    通过制定合理的备份计划、分类存储BAK文件、定期测试恢复过程等措施,企业可以在关键时刻迅速恢复数据并减少损失

     六、结语 BAK文件作为数据备份的重要工具,在数据恢复、版本管理和灾难恢复等方面发挥着举足轻重的作用

    然而,要充分发挥BAK文件的作用,需要用户养成良好的备份习惯、掌握正确的恢复方法以及遵循最佳的实践指南

    通过本文的全面解析和实战技巧分享,希望能够帮助用户更好地利用BAK文件来保障数据的安全性和可用性

    在未来的日子里,让我们携手共进,共同守护数据的安全底线!

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道